Well, I'm upgrading from my 1650 to an rx 6650 xt and I need a powerful PSU as my 450w one can't handle it. I have a low budget on psu, so I found the DeepCool PF700 for 55 bucks from a guy I know. It's a 700w psu and it has an 80+ white rating. Is it good or it will fail/explode/burn down my pc?

This PSU looks like crap, Tier E "avoid" at PSUCultists...

RX6650 isn't that hungry at 175W it should work with a 450W PSU, that' s the recommended minimum, and at least you won' t spend money
